21. To ask the Minister for Health his plans to provide a day care centre in Youghal in County Cork;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[27650/15]

The proposed Day Care Centre in Youghal, for which a site was allocated at Youghal Community Hospital, was included in the HSE's Capital Plan in 2008. However, as with many other projects, funds were not available to progress this project due to the reduced capital budget which followed the down turn in the economy.

Subsequent to the initiation of the Day Care Centre project, the inspection of residential services for older people by the Health Information and Quality Authority commenced. The renewal of the registration for Youghal Community Hospital comes up in 2015. It has been established that the hospital will require a significant extension to fully comply with HIQA's infrastructural standards. The HSE has undertaken a preliminary review of the existing community hospital and, given the topography of the hospital site, such an extension could well impact on the site set aside for the proposed Day Centre.

The HSE has appointed a Design Team to develop the plans to achieve full HIQA compliance for Youghal Community Hospital. One of the first tasks assigned to the design team is to advise on whether the significant extensions required to the hospital will impact on the site designated for the Day Care Centre. Naturally, the intention will be to avoid impact if reasonably possible. Once this step is completed, the HSE can make a final decision on the whether the Day Care Centre can go ahead on the site originally set aside. Capital funding will be required to progress the project at that stage and it will also have to be confirmed that the revenue funding needed to operate the centre once completed can be made available.
